#region Enumerations
[Flags, System.ComponentModel.TypeConverter( typeof( SymbianParserLib.TypeConverters.SymbianEnumConverter ) )]
public enum TProcessFlags : uint
{
EProcessFlagNone = 0x00000000,
EProcessFlagSystemCritical = 0x00000004, // process panic reboots entire system
EProcessFlagSystemPermanent = 0x00000008, // process exit of any kind reboots entire system
EProcessFlagPriorityControl = 0x40000000,
EProcessFlagJustInTime = 0x80000000,
}
[Flags, System.ComponentModel.TypeConverter( typeof( SymbianParserLib.TypeConverters.SymbianEnumConverter ) )]
public enum TProcessAttributes : uint
{
ENone = 0x00000000,
EPrivate = 0x00000002,
EResumed = 0x00010000,
EBeingLoaded = 0x08000000,
ESupervisor = 0x80000000,
}
#endregion
